Madison, Wisconsin

Madison, Wisconsin has repeatedly been ranked as the best or one of the best places in the nation to live, work, and raise a family. Wisconsin's capitol is located on an isthmus between lakes Monona and Mendota. There are many parks, lakes, restaurants, and cultural offerings in Madison and its surrounding cities. The Greater Madison Area offers everything from going to the farmer's market on the capitol square to visiting the Frank Lloyd Wright's Taliesin estate. Madison has many first rate educational institutions such as The University of Wisconsin - Madison, Edgewood College, and Madison Area Technical College.

Minneapolis, Minnesota

Minneapolis, Minnesota noted as a city that is both beautiful and cosmopolitan. It is the home of professional football, baseball, and basketball teams. It is also noted for the world-famous Mall of America as the largest indoor shopping and entertainment complex in the country, with more than 500 stores, the Camp Snoopy amusement park, an aquarium, 14 theater screens, and a wide variety of restaurants and nightclubs. Minneapolis is also nearby the University of Minnesota, which is a world-class university known globally as a leader in teaching, research, and public service and is consistently ranked among the top 20 public universities in the nation. Minnesota is known for its 10,000 lakes and is a tourist's paradise.
